Typical Limousine Rental Prices in Washington, D.C.
Understanding the typical price ranges for different limousine types and packages in D.C. will help you set realistic expectations and avoid sticker shock.
Average Hourly Rates by Limousine Type
Hourly pricing varies based on the vehicle’s size, amenities, and exclusivity. Here’s what you can generally expect:
Stretch Limousine Pricing
Stretch limos usually range from $95 to $150 per hour, with a minimum rental period of 2–3 hours. This rate covers most standard amenities and is suitable for small groups.
SUV Limousine Pricing
SUV limousines often cost $125 to $200 per hour. The higher price reflects their larger capacity and additional features.
Party Bus Pricing
Party buses are typically priced between $175 and $350 per hour, depending on size and luxury level. These vehicles cater to groups of 15–30 and are popular for nights out and celebrations.
Luxury Sedan Pricing
Luxury sedans start around $70 to $120 per hour, making them an affordable option for business travel or airport transfers with a touch of refinement.
Exotic Limo Pricing
Exotic limousines and specialty vehicles can command $250 to $500 or more per hour due to their rarity and high-end finishes. For a deeper understanding of what makes these vehicles unique, you may find our article on exotic car rental in Washington, D.C. helpful.
Flat Rate Packages: What Do They Include?
Many companies offer flat-rate packages for specific needs, providing budget certainty and bundled services.
Airport Transfers
Flat fees for airport transfers typically range from $120 to $250 depending on the distance, vehicle type, and airport. These packages usually include meet-and-greet service and luggage assistance.
Weddings and Special Events
Wedding packages often bundle multiple hours, red carpet service, champagne, and decorations. Expect to pay $500 to $1,500 depending on the size and length of service.
Prom and Graduation Packages
Prom packages are designed with safety and fun in mind, frequently including non-alcoholic refreshments, decorative lighting, and return trips. Pricing ranges from $600 to $1,200 for the evening.
Corporate and Business Travel
Corporate clients benefit from streamlined booking, discreet service, and luxury amenities. Packages may start at $300 for half-day rentals or $600 for a full day.
Additional Fees and Hidden Costs to Watch For
To avoid surprises, always read the fine print and ask your provider about possible extra charges. Here are some common fees to watch for:
Fuel Surcharges
Some companies add a fuel surcharge, especially for long-distance trips or during periods of high gas prices. This fee is usually a percentage of the base rate.
Cleaning and Damage Fees
Excessive mess or damage to the vehicle may result in cleaning or repair charges. Clarify what is considered “normal wear and tear” before your event.
Overtime Charges
If your event runs longer than anticipated, overtime is billed in 15- or 30-minute increments at a higher hourly rate. Be mindful of your schedule to avoid these fees.
Tolls and Parking Fees
Tolls and parking are often billed separately, particularly for routes that pass through toll roads or require special event parking.
Taxes and Administrative Fees
State and local taxes, as well as administrative fees, are typically added to your final bill. Request a detailed quote to understand the total cost.

Sample Cost Scenarios for Popular Events
To give you a practical sense of what to budget, here are some sample cost scenarios based on real-world events in D.C.
Wedding Limousine Rental Costs
A typical wedding package for a stretch limo (5 hours, including decorations and champagne) ranges from $800 to $1,200. Upgrades for exotic vehicles or longer coverage increase the rate.
Prom Night Limousine Costs
For prom, a group sharing a stretch SUV limousine for 6 hours can expect a total of $1,000 to $1,500, divided among all passengers. Packages emphasize safety and fun amenities.
Corporate Event Limousine Costs
Business events often require luxury sedans or SUVs. A full-day executive service with multiple stops may run $600 to $1,200, depending on itinerary complexity.
Airport Transfer Limousine Costs
One-way airport transfers in a standard sedan or stretch limo typically cost $120 to $250, with higher rates for large groups or luxury vehicles.
Night Out or Party Limousine Costs
A party bus for a night out (5 hours, up to 20 people) can cost $1,200 to $1,800, including entertainment features and basic refreshments.
Frequently Asked Questions About Limousine Rental Costs in D.C.
We address common questions to help you make informed decisions and avoid unexpected issues when renting a limousine in Washington, D.C.
How Far in Advance Should I Book?
For popular dates—prom season, holidays, or major events—book at least 2–3 months ahead. For regular weekends, 2–4 weeks is usually sufficient.
Can I Bring My Own Drinks or Food?
Most companies allow you to bring your own non-alcoholic beverages and snacks. For alcoholic drinks, check local laws and company policies, as regulations vary by vehicle and event type.
What Happens If My Event Runs Late?
If your event runs past the scheduled end time, overtime charges apply. These are typically billed at a higher hourly rate, so it’s wise to factor in extra time when booking.
Are There Age Restrictions for Limousine Rentals?
Some companies require a minimum age for contractual purposes, and alcohol policies are strictly enforced for underage passengers. Always confirm these details before booking.
How Can I Avoid Hidden Fees?
Request an itemized quote and clarify what is included. Ask about fuel, gratuity, overtime, and cleaning fees upfront to avoid surprises.
